  • Eastwoodhill Arboretum: A beautiful arboretum showcasing a diverse collection of trees and plants, perfect for family outings. Enjoy tranquil walks amidst stunning flora, and take in the breathtaking landscapes that change with the seasons.
  • Gisborne Botanic Gardens: A picturesque garden ideal for a romantic stroll or family picnic. Explore vibrant flower beds, serene pathways, and the charming duck pond, all set against a scenic backdrop.
  • Tairawhiti Museum: A cultural gem that delves into the rich history of the region. Engage with fascinating exhibits that celebrate local heritage, art, and Maori culture, providing a deeper understanding of Gisborne's past.

Things to do recommended for couples

For a romantic getaway in Mangapapa, enjoy wine tasting at Gisborne Wine Centre or Longbush Wines, both only 3.2km away. For a slightly longer jaunt, visit Bushmere Estate, 6.4km away, where you can soak in the beautiful surroundings and savour exquisite local wines.

Things to do recommended for families

Families visiting Mangapapa can experience the wonders of the Cook Observatory, a delightful planetarium located 3.2km away, offering an entertaining and educational atmosphere perfect for kids. It's a fantastic spot to spark curiosity about the stars and planets.
